Output 09384ab870fbcb367b8602e38fc02547c5fc828bcce11f9570b51e471ac5362e:22

value
21000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b4e5d92432ea84d5ee577c618dd71861737bae0 OP_EQUAL
address
35dzrivzepLqdbCcLHGfQeAUJ7VaMCWnF2
transaction
09384ab870fbcb367b8602e38fc02547c5fc828bcce11f9570b51e471ac5362e
spent
true